UAB “MOGEMAS” has been creating quality products since 1995.
The company currently makes five types of hematogen, enriched with various vitamins and valuable additives. The products meet all European Union requirements and an HACCP food safety system is in place.
MOGEMAS Hematogen products are well known and loved by consumers, so we are constantly developing new formulas and recipes. Our products are sold in Lithuania and exported to EU countries, the USA and Canada.
An iron source of animal origin, with roots going back to the late 19th century.
Hematogen (Greek Haematogenum – “blood-producing”, renewing) appeared as a food supplement in Switzerland: in 1890 Dr. Hommel created a mixture based on cattle blood. Since then hematogen has changed its form but improved its properties, enriched with vitamins.
Hematogen is an iron source of animal origin. When the body lacks iron, one feels tired and weak, concentration declines, vital processes slow down and productivity drops. According to the World Health Organization, about 30% of the population experiences a deficiency of this element.
Iron is one of the key components that enable biochemical reactions in cells and supply organs and tissues with oxygen. Oxygen reaches tissues via the blood protein haemoglobin, of which iron is one of the main constituents. The human body contains about 3–5 g of iron, more than two thirds of it in haemoglobin.
One form of iron deficiency is anaemia, when the number of red blood cells or the amount of haemoglobin drops and the body experiences oxygen starvation. Almost one in three people worldwide suffers from anaemia; it is more common in women and children – around 30% of children and about 50% of pregnant women have an iron deficiency.
The body does not produce iron itself – we get it from food. Iron of animal origin has a considerably higher absorption rate (about 20–30% is absorbed) compared with iron of plant origin, which is absorbed less. Vitamin C significantly improves absorption, which is why all Lithuanian hematogens are enriched with it.
The WHO and UNICEF recommend taking iron supplements. Hematogen is especially important for those at risk of iron-deficiency anaemia: growing children and teenagers, pregnant and breastfeeding women, athletes and active people, and the elderly.
